Pinpoint Test X : P0C03
- NOTE: The Inverter System Controller (ISC) is referred to as the SOBDMC (Secondary On-Board Diagnostic Control Module C) in the scan tool.NOTE: Drive Motor B refers to the electric generator. Drive Motor A refers to the electric motor.
Normal Operation and Fault Conditions
REFER to: Electric Powertrain Control - System Operation and Component Description .
DTC Fault Trigger Conditions
DTC Description Fault Trigger Condition SOBDMC P0C03:00 Drive Motor "B" Current Low: No Sub Type Information This DTC sets when the 3 phase current is not within the expected range or when the resolver circuitry is incorrectly wired. Possible Sources
- Wiring, terminals or connectors
- Transmission
- X1 CHECK FOR INVERTER SYSTEM CONTROLLER (ISC) DIAGNOSTIC TROUBLE CODES (DTCS)
- Ignition ON.
- Using a diagnostic scan tool, run the Inverter System Controller (ISC) self-test.
Was DTC P0A45 or P0C64 read from the Inverter System Controller (ISC)?
Yes GO to Pinpoint Test Q No GO to X2 - X2 CHECK THE INVERTER SYSTEM CONTROLLER (ISC) CALIBRATION LEVEL
- Verify the Inverter System Controller (ISC) is at the latest calibration level.
Is the Inverter System Controller (ISC) at the latest calibration level?
Yes GO to X3 No UPDATE the Inverter System Controller (ISC) to the latest calibration level. - X3 VISUAL INSPECTION OF THE HIGH VOLTAGE SYSTEM
- Remove the Inverter System Controller (ISC) side cover. When removing side cover, pull cover straight out approximately 2 inches before moving upwards or damage to the high voltage interlock connector may occur. REFER to: Inverter System Controller [SOBDMC] .
- Examine all the high voltage connections for damage and loose or broken conditions.
- Verify the high voltage terminal bolts are fully seated and torqued to 8 lb.ft (10.5 Nm)
Is a concern present?
Yes REPAIR as necessary. CLEAR the Inverter System Controller (ISC) DTCs and REPEAT the self-test. No GO to X4 - X4 CHECK FOR GENERATOR PHASE CONTINUITY

- X5 CHECK THE GENERATOR CIRCUITS FOR A SHORT TO GROUND
- Measure and record:
Positive Lead Measurement / Action Negative Lead
ISC/SOBDMC pin 6, component sideGround
ISC/SOBDMC pin 7, component sideGround
ISC/SOBDMC pin 8, component sideGround
Is the resistance greater than 10K ohms?
Yes GO to X6 No With the aid of the wiring diagram, REPAIR the short circuit. CLEAR the Inverter System Controller (ISC) DTCs. REPEAT the self-test. - Measure and record:

Yes GO to X7 No With the aid of the wiring diagram, REPAIR the open circuit. CLEAR the Inverter System Controller (ISC) DTCs. REPEAT the self-test. - X7 CHECK FOR CORRECT INVERTER SYSTEM CONTROLLER (ISC) OPERATION
- Ignition OFF.
- Disconnect and inspect all Inverter System Controller (ISC) connectors.
- Repair:
- corrosion (install new connector or terminals - clean module pins)
- damaged or bent pins - install new terminals/pins
- pushed-out pins - install new pins as necessary
- Reconnect all Inverter System Controller (ISC) connectors. Make sure they seat and latch correctly.
- Install the Inverter System Controller (ISC) side cover. REFER to: Inverter System Controller [SOBDMC] .
- Connect HF45 Transmission C1111.
- Ignition ON.
- CLEAR the Inverter System Controller (ISC) DTCs.
- Ignition OFF.
- Wait 5 minutes.
- Ignition ON.
- Using a diagnostic scan tool, run the Inverter System Controller (ISC) self-test.
Is DTC P0C03:00 still present?
Yes INSTALL a new Transmission. REFER to: Transmission . CLEAR the Inverter System Controller (ISC) DTCs. REPEAT the self-test. No The system is operating correctly at this time. The concern may have been caused by module connections. ADDRESS the root cause of any connector or pin issues.
